Steak Queso Rice is a hearty and flavorful dish that combines tender steak, creamy queso, and fluffy rice. This one-pot meal is per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or a satisfying lunch, packed with protein and delicious flavors!
Ingredients
- 1 pound flank steak (or sirloin, thinly sliced)
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on chili powder
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
- 1 cup uncooked white rice (or brown rice)
- 2 cups beef broth (or water)
- 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ar or a Mexican blend)
- 1 cup queso cheese dip (store-bought or homemade)
- 1/2 cup diced tomatoes (fresh or canned, drained)
- 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ro (for garnish)
- Sour cream (for serving, optional)
- Sliced jalapeños (for serving, optional)
Timing
Making Steak Queso Rice takes about 10 minutes for preparation and 25-30 minutes for cooking.
Instructions
Step 1: Cook the Steak
- Season Steak: In a bowl, season the sliced steak with garlic powder, onion powder, chili powder, salt, and pepper.
- Sear Steak: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the seasoned steak and cook for about 3-4 minutes until browned and cooked to your desired doneness. Remove the steak from the skillet and set aside.
Step 2: Cook the Rice
- Add Rice: In the same skillet, add the uncooked rice and toast it for about 1-2 minutes, stirring frequently.
- Add Broth: Pour in the beef broth, b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over and simmer for about 15-20 minutes, or until the rice is cooked and the liquid is absorbed.
Step 3: Combine Ingredients
- Mix in Queso and Steak: Once the rice is cooked, stir in the queso cheese dip, shredded cheese, diced tomatoes, and the cooked steak. Mix until everything is well combined and heated through.
Step 4: Serve
- Garnish: Remove from heat and garnish with chopped cilantro. Serve warm with sour cream and sliced jalapeños if desired.

Nutritional Information
Here’s a quick overview of the nutritional content of Steak Queso Rice (per serving, based on 4 servings):
| Nutrient | Amount per Serving |
|---|---|
| Calories | 550 |
| Protein | 30g |
| Fat | 25g |
| Carbohydrates | 50g |
| Fiber | 2g |
| Sugar | 2g |
Tips for Customization
- Add Vegetables: Incorporate bell peppers, corn, or black beans for added nutrition and flavor.
- Spice Level: Adjust the spice level by adding more chili powder or including diced jalapeños in the cooking process.
- Different Proteins: Substitute the steak with grilled chicken, shrimp, or tofu for a different protein option.
